PRECAUTIONS

The output jack is an EIAJ-standard 1/4" phone jack. Be sure to use

an appropriate connection cable.

The built-in preamplifier is automatically turned on when a plug is

inserted into the output jack. When not using the instrument, or when

playing it without amplification, be sure to remove the plug from the

output jack so that the preamplifier power is turned off.

Always set the VOLUME control to “0” when plugging in or

unplugging the connection cable.

The battery check indicator (BATT.) will light briefly when a plug is

inserted or removed from the output jack. This is normal and does not

indicate a malfunction.

Be sure to remove the battery if the instrument will not be used for an

extended period of time in order to prevent possible damage due to

battery leakage.

BATTERY REPLACEMENT

Be sure to replace the battery as soon as possible when the battery check

indicator lights in order to avoid reduced sound quality.

* Be sure to remove the battery if the instrument will not be used for an

extended period of time in order to prevent possible damage due to battery
leakage.

q

Press the catch on the battery holder in the direction indicated by the arrow

in the illustration in order to unlock it.

w

Slide out the battery case.

e

Remove the old battery from the battery case, and insert the new battery

making sure that the (+) and (–) terminals of the battery are positioned as

shown in the illustration. Use only a DC9V, S-006P (6F22) or equivalent

battery.

r

Slide the battery case back into the battery holder and press firmly so

that the battery case locks into place.

THE CONTROLS

q

VOL. (Volume) Control

Adjusts the overall output volume level.

* Make sure that the VOL. is turned to “0” before connecting or

disconnecting.

w

BATT. (Battery Check) Indicator

This indicator will light when the battery needs to be replaced.

Please replace the battery as soon as possible when the BATT. indicator

lights.

e

3 Band Equalizer

LOW

: Boosts or cuts the level of the low frequencies.

MID

: Boosts or cuts the level of the middle frequencies.

The AMF control 

r

 adjusts the center frequency of the band

affected by this control.

HIGH

: Boosts or cuts the level of the high frequencies.

r

AMF Control

Sets the center frequency of the band of frequencies affected by the MID

equalizer control. The range is from 80 Hz to 10 kHz.

* This control has no effect when the MID equalizer control is set to its center

(“0”) position.
